-
PDO与MySQLi深度对比及选型策略
所属栏目:[语言] 日期:2025-09-23 热度:0
PDO(PHP Data Objects)和MySQLi都是PHP中用于操作数据库的扩展,但它们的设计理念和使用场景有所不同。PDO是一个更通用的数据库访问层,支持多种数据库类型,而MySQLi则专为MySQL设计,提供了更丰富的MySQL特定[详细]
-
云养码农:Python数据挖掘实战精要
所属栏目:[语言] 日期:2025-09-23 热度:0
云养码农,顾名思义,是那些在云端默默耕耘的程序员们。他们不靠键盘敲出世界,而是用代码编织未来。 Python作为数据挖掘的利器,早已成为云养码农手中的得力工具。它简洁的语法和丰富的库,让复杂的数据处[详细]
-
C++ STL高效应用:从入门到精通
所属栏目:[语言] 日期:2025-09-23 热度:0
C++ STL(标准模板库)是C++语言中非常重要的一部分,它提供了丰富的数据结构和算法,极大提高了开发效率。掌握STL不仅能提升代码质量,还能让程序运行更加高效。 STL的核心组件包括容器、迭代器、算法和仿[详细]
-
Rust内存管理与核心特性深度解析
所属栏目:[语言] 日期:2025-09-23 热度:0
Rust 是一种现代系统编程语言,以其强大的内存安全性和性能著称。与其他语言不同,Rust 通过独特的所有权(ownership)和借用(borrowing)机制,在编译时就能检测并防止常见的内存错误,如空指针解引用、数据竞[详细]
-
Rust内存安全机制与管理策略解析
所属栏目:[语言] 日期:2025-09-23 热度:0
Rust通过所有权(Ownership)和借用(Borrowing)机制,确保了内存的安全性。这种机制在编译时就能检测到大多数常见的内存错误,如空指针解引用、数据竞争等。 在Rust中,每个值都有一个所有者,且只能有一[详细]
-
探秘Rust:解锁高效内存管理奥秘
所属栏目:[语言] 日期:2025-09-23 热度:0
Rust 是一种现代系统编程语言,以其独特的内存管理机制而闻名。它通过编译时的检查和所有权系统的巧妙设计,避免了传统语言中常见的内存泄漏和悬空指针问题。 在 Rust 中,每个变量都有一个所有者,这个所有[详细]
-
C++ STL高效应用:技巧与实战
所属栏目:[语言] 日期:2025-09-23 热度:0
C++标准模板库(STL)是C++编程中不可或缺的一部分,它提供了丰富的数据结构和算法,能够显著提升开发效率。掌握STL的高效应用,可以让代码更简洁、更高效。 容器是STL的核心,包括vector、list、map等。选择[详细]
-
Python数据分析高效技巧实战
所属栏目:[语言] 日期:2025-09-23 热度:0
Python在数据分析领域广泛应用,掌握一些高效技巧可以显著提升工作效率。使用Pandas库时,合理利用其内置函数能减少代码量并提高性能。 数据清洗是分析前的关键步骤,通过dropna()和fillna()可以快速处理缺[详细]
-
解密JavaScript事件机制核心原理
所属栏目:[语言] 日期:2025-09-23 热度:0
JavaScript事件机制是前端开发中不可或缺的一部分,它使得网页能够响应用户的操作,如点击、滚动、输入等。理解其核心原理有助于开发者更高效地编写交互性强的代码。 AI生成内容图,仅供参考 事件流描述了事[详细]
-
C++ STL高效应用与性能优化
所属栏目:[语言] 日期:2025-09-23 热度:0
C++ STL(标准模板库)是C++语言中非常重要的组成部分,它提供了丰富的容器、算法和迭代器,能够显著提升开发效率。合理使用STL可以减少代码量,同时提高程序的可读性和可维护性。 在选择容器时,应根据具体[详细]
-
Rust内存管理机制与实践精要
所属栏目:[语言] 日期:2025-09-23 热度:0
Rust内存管理机制以所有权(ownership)和借用(borrowing)为核心,通过编译时的静态检查来确保内存安全。这种设计避免了传统语言中常见的空指针、重复释放等错误。 在Rust中,每个值都有一个所有者,当所[详细]
-
C++ STL高效应用优化秘籍
所属栏目:[语言] 日期:2025-09-23 热度:0
C++ STL(标准模板库)是C++编程中非常强大的工具,合理使用可以显著提升代码效率和可维护性。 选择合适的数据结构是优化的第一步。例如,频繁插入和删除操作时,应优先考虑`std::list`或`std::forward_lis[详细]
-
Python数据分析高效入门与实战
所属栏目:[语言] 日期:2025-09-23 热度:0
Python在数据分析领域越来越受欢迎,主要是因为它语法简洁、功能强大,并且拥有丰富的库支持。对于初学者来说,掌握Python的基础知识是迈向数据分析的第一步。AI生成内容图,仅供参考 数据分析通常包括数据清[详细]
-
Ruby on Rails从零到一快速入门
所属栏目:[语言] 日期:2025-09-23 热度:0
Ruby on Rails 是一个基于 Ruby 语言的 Web 应用框架,以其简洁和高效著称。它提供了一套完整的工具和约定,帮助开发者快速构建功能丰富的网站。 安装 Ruby on Rails 前,需要先安装 Ruby。可以通过官方文档[详细]
-
JavaScript事件机制与事件流模型解析
所属栏目:[语言] 日期:2025-09-23 热度:0
JavaScript事件机制是网页交互的核心,它允许开发者响应用户的操作,如点击、输入、滚动等。事件机制通过监听特定的事件,当事件发生时执行相应的处理函数。 事件流模型描述了事件在DOM树中的传播路径。早期[详细]
-
PDO与MySQLi对比及选用指南
所属栏目:[语言] 日期:2025-09-23 热度:0
PDO(PHP Data Objects)和MySQLi是PHP中用于操作MySQL数据库的两种主要扩展。它们都提供了面向对象的接口,但各自有不同的特点和适用场景。 PDO支持多种数据库,包括MySQL、PostgreSQL、SQLite等,这使得它在[详细]
-
Ruby on Rails速成:高效开发入门
所属栏目:[语言] 日期:2025-09-23 热度:0
Ruby on Rails 是一个基于 Ruby 语言的 Web 应用框架,以其简洁和高效著称。它遵循“约定优于配置”的原则,让开发者能够快速搭建应用,减少重复代码。 安装 Ruby 和 Rails 非常简单。首先需要安装 Ruby 环[详细]
-
Ruby on Rails新手快速入门指南
所属栏目:[语言] 日期:2025-09-23 热度:0
Ruby on Rails 是一个基于 Ruby 语言的 Web 应用框架,它强调约定优于配置,使得开发更加高效。Rails 提供了丰富的内置功能,如数据库操作、路由设置和视图渲染,帮助开发者快速构建应用。 安装 Ruby on Ra[详细]
-
JavaScript事件机制:捕获与冒泡深度解析
所属栏目:[语言] 日期:2025-09-23 热度:0
JavaScript事件机制是网页交互的核心之一,理解事件的传播过程对于开发高效且可维护的代码至关重要。事件在DOM节点之间传播时,通常会经历两个阶段:捕获阶段和冒泡阶段。 捕获阶段是从最外层元素开始,向目标[详细]
-
云养码农:Rust内存安全底层揭秘
所属栏目:[语言] 日期:2025-09-23 热度:0
云养码农今天来聊聊Rust的内存安全机制,这玩意儿可不是闹着玩的。 Rust通过所有权系统和借用检查器,让开发者在编译期就能避免很多常见的内存错误。 比如说,你不能同时拥有一个变量的多个可变引用,[详细]
-
云养码农:Rust内存管理深度揭秘
所属栏目:[语言] 日期:2025-09-23 热度:0
云养码农今天来聊聊Rust的内存管理,这玩意儿可是Rust最让人拍案叫绝的地方之一。 AI生成内容图,仅供参考 Rust通过所有权(ownership)和借用(borrowing)机制,让程序员在编译期就能避免很多常见的内存错[详细]
-
JavaScript事件机制与事件流深度解析
所属栏目:[语言] 日期:2025-09-23 热度:0
AI生成内容图,仅供参考 JavaScript事件机制是网页交互的核心,它允许开发者响应用户操作或浏览器行为。当用户点击按钮、滚动页面或提交表单时,JavaScript会通过事件来捕获这些动作并执行相应的代码。 事件流[详细]
-
PDO与MySQLi性能对比及选用策略
所属栏目:[语言] 日期:2025-09-23 热度:0
PHP中与MySQL数据库交互的两种主要扩展是PDO(PHP Data Objects)和MySQLi(MySQL Improved)。两者都支持面向对象编程,但在设计和功能上存在差异。 PDO提供了一个统一的接口来访问多种数据库,包括MySQL、P[详细]
-
云养码农:Rails速成,零基础实战捷径
所属栏目:[语言] 日期:2025-09-23 热度:0
云养码农,不是说你不需要动手,而是教你如何用最短的时间,快速上手Rails。零基础也能找到方向,关键在于选对方法。 AI生成内容图,仅供参考 Rails的生态很友好,官方文档和社区资源丰富,适合新手入门。别[详细]
-
Ruby on Rails新手速成入门指南
所属栏目:[语言] 日期:2025-09-23 热度:0
Ruby on Rails,简称 Rails,是一个基于 Ruby 语言的 Web 应用框架,以其简洁、高效和开发速度快而闻名。它遵循“约定优于配置”的原则,让开发者能够快速搭建功能完善的网站。 安装 Rails 之前,需要先安装[详细]
